Output e66a1ed329095fdbe6fb17bc46d7cde21e79f29d2de9e534a84954c74b475396:0

value
25000000
script pubkey
OP_0 OP_PUSHBYTES_32 a131d611cd0b1ebc1cb70f91575bfa269f753b62bd1f4c99ee0cb60107e09ed4
address
bc1q5ycavywdpv0tc89hp7g4wkl6y60h2wmzh505ex0wpjmqzplqnm2q57l9h7
transaction
e66a1ed329095fdbe6fb17bc46d7cde21e79f29d2de9e534a84954c74b475396
spent
true